The law on the registration of sales was introduced in the Czech Republic in several phases. Different deadlines applied to companies from different sectors for the conversion of cash register systems or electronic recording systems to "EET" (Elektronická evidence tržeb).
The EET system was introduced to combat tax evasion and ensure tax honesty among businesses. The law on the registration of sales in the Czech Republic was introduced in several phases to gradually integrate various industries into the EET system (Electronic Registration of Sales).
In the EET system, POS systems must transmit all transaction data (receipt data) directly to the tax authority.
The tax authority's servers confirm the receipts using a unique code (FIK - Fiscal Identification Code)
Companies must issue receipts (incl. FIK) to customers.
To participate in the EET system, companies must register on the Czech tax authority's EET portal.
